WebApproved Hepatitis B Drugs for Adults (United States) Oral Antivirals (Nucleos (t)ide Analogues) Tenofovir disoproxil (Viread) is a pill taken once a day, with few side effects, for at least one year or longer. This is considered a first-line treatment with an excellent resistance profile. (Approved in 2008)

WebApr 13, 2024 · Hepatitis B medications are recommended for patients with detected HBV virus (also known as hepatitis B viral load) on a blood test and evidence of liver damage. Liver damage can be detected with a liver enzyme known as ALT. People with cirrhosis should be considered for treatment even if the liver enzymes appear normal. WebApr 12, 2024 · It now recommends that everyone over age 18 be tested for hepatitis B at least once in their lifetime. This is the first change in testing recommendations since 2008 and makes testing universal for adults, rather than based on whether a person has any risk factors for hepatitis B infection.
